Position

Operations Manager

Location

Edmonton, AB

Reports to

Regional Vice President


Scope
The Operations Manager has overall responsibility for performance of the inside sales and warehouse teams, as well as reception. This role is accountable for service quality, efficiency and cost effectiveness by controlling expenses, ensuring customer service levels are met and achieving sales and profits as outlined in annual budgets. The Operations Manager is also responsible for maintaining inventories at efficient levels which are sufficient to support customers' on-time delivery requirements.

Responsibilities & Accountabilities

  • - Development, implementation and maintenance of sound operations management principles, practices and procedures, including documentation and revision as necessary. Ensure Company policies, procedures & practices are complied with.
  • Customer Service: Interface with existing customers to secure continuing sales and maintain strong customer relationships.
  • Inventory: Manages inventories efficiently and effectively so that "Inventory Turns" are a minimum of target, obsolete stock is disposed of on a regular basis, top moving items are in adequate supply using min/max inventory management processes, reduce slow-moving items, and restocking patterns continually evolve with customers changing requirements.
  • Staff:Supervises and manages inside sales/reception and warehouse staff. Motivates and leads by communicating objectives and expectations, by providing positive feedback on a continual basis, by setting a proactive and positive example, and by ensuring accountability for achieving results.
  • Manages the pricing function to achieve margin expectations, ensuring flexibility in gaining large volume and/or new customer accounts.
  • Assist with preparation of budget forecasts and targets for senior management. Provide feedback and recommendations on new products, services
  • Manage branch expenses and ensure administration and management related functions of the branch are conducted in a timely and professional manner
  • Conducts other activities and initiatives as required/assigned by the Regional Vice President
